PPSSPPSSPPSS Charter Summary
• The purpose of the PPSS is to define, develop and implement solutions to improve the program planning and execution practices throughout Industry and DoD
– The initial focus will be on gaining consistency, predictability and usefulness of program schedules
• Specific deliverable products have been indentified as part of the charter:
– Develop a joint Industry and DoD schedule management implementation guide – Develop a joint training curriculum for all levels of Industry and DoD management– Develop approach to favorably influence recruiting, training and retention of
planning talent– Sponsor an Industry Day for DoD consultants and software tool vendors– Develop a joint cultural change management plan to be implemented across
Industry and DoD

PPSS PRODUCT Development Progress
PPSS PRODUCT:– Develop a set of Generally Accepted Scheduling Principles (GASP) for use in
the PPSS governance process
Status: • Final draft GASP has been developed• GASP defines eight principles that describe a valid and effective schedule
1. Complete 5. Predictive
2. Traceable 6. Usable
3. Transparent 7. Resourced
4. Statused 8. Controlled
Next Steps:• Formally finalize and publish GASP and narratives• Begin applicable governance process using GASP
GASP provides a governance framework and forms the basis for other PPSS products
